Stanley Tucci Brings Vine Talk to Paso Robles
The latest episode of PBS TV series Vine Talk has a Central California flavor. Premiering over the weekend, “Zeroing in on Zinfandels” sent actor-host Stanley Tucci to the Paso Robles region to sample a concoction first bottled in California in 1857.
If you haven’t seen the program, it’s a pleasant diversion, with Tucci joined by various wine experts and celebrity guests such as, in this case, former New York Mets pitcher Ron Darling and Grammy nominated violinist Philippe Quint. Two of the six Zinfandels sampled in the episode come from companies with literary sounding names — Victor Hugo Winery and Steinbeck Vineyards & Winery — but in each case, there is no connection.
